What to Know Before You Buy Used Mercury Racing Outboard Equipment
A buyer planning to buy used Mercury Racing outboard equipment should first identify the boat specifications, required shaft length, existing controls, steering system, fuel arrangement, electrical demands, and operating environment. Proper documentation helps determine whether the package is compatible and whether additional controls, steering equipment, mounting hardware, fuel components, or electrical work are necessary.
Used-engine inspection should include a genuine cold start, diagnostic scan, operating-hour verification, oil-condition review, cooling-system check, gearcase inspection, and corrosion evaluation. Whenever possible, conduct an under-load water test instead of relying only on an idle demonstration, short running video, or seller description.

Selecting the Right Marine Propulsion System
A marine propulsion system should be treated as one complete arrangement that includes the motor, transom, propeller, controls, steering, fuel components, electrical equipment, and hull. If one component is poorly matched, the motor may experience excessive load, vibration, inefficient fuel use, limited rpm, weak acceleration, difficult handling, or shortened service life.
Proper commissioning includes a loaded test of engine speed, cooling, controls, handling, vibration, acceleration, shifting, and system tightness. Test results may show that propeller pitch, diameter, or blade design needs refinement to achieve the correct engine load and operating rpm.
